My research background is in organic electronics, physics, computer modeling, and self-assembly processes, with the focus of utilizing those to create new functional materials as the building blocks of novel soft-electronic devices. I have developed during my PhD Nanoparticles organic memory field effect transistors (NOMFETs) at the Institute of electronic, microelectronics and nanotechnology with the guidance of Prof. Kamal Lmimouni and Prof. Adel Kalboussi combining skills and knowledge in both nanotechnology (Electrical Eng.) and Materials Eng.
To expand these concepts, I focused on developing new kind of memory devices based double floating gate made of gold nanoparticles and reduced graphene oxide. My main interest is to boost the memory performence (endurence, memory window and retention time).
I was a research and teaching assistant in different engeneering schools and university such as "Ecole Centrale Lille", "IMT Lille-Douai" and "University of Lille". I have integrated AIMAN-Films Group where I have worked on modelling and fabrication of Phononic Crystal Surface Acoustic Waves Sensors.
I have also an experienced the Job of a Dream consultant in private company "Techshop Les Ateliers Leroy Merlin" where I supervised many projects in the field of IOT's, Robotics ...
Actually, I work as associate professor in ICAM Institut a school ingeneering in Lille
